MTKClient serves as a versatile alternative to traditional proprietary tools like . Unlike standard flashing methods that often require official authorization or signed "Download Agents" (DA), MTKClient uses exploits like Kamakiri to bypass security protocols such as Serial Link Authentication (SLA) and Download Agent Authentication (DAA).
